Brazil is rated as one particular of the world’s ten most dangerous nations around the world, by crime fee. In 2020, it experienced a homicide fee of 23.6 incidents per one hundred,000 men and women, despite the fact that this does signify a sizeable fall from a peak of 30.eight homicides for each one hundred,000 in preceding many years.

A great deal of the country’s violent incidents stem from a high structured criminal offense rate with warring factions, the Primeira Commando Capital and Red Command, intensely included in drug trade and trafficking, kidnapping, and extortion. Although this indicates that several of the homicides and violent crimes take place in between rival gangs and the law enforcement, violence does spill above and can require inhabitants and visitors.

In 2017, a vacationer was accidentally shot dead by police whilst on a favela tour. Steering clear of the favelas, or shantytowns, minimizes the danger of witnessing or turning out to be included in violent incidents but it doesn’t totally get rid of the danger.

State: Bahia
Population: 620,000

Feira de Santana is the next biggest city in the condition of Bahia and is arguably the most harmful city in the complete of Brazil. It is a former cattle industry town, where it receives its identify, and it is common for its festivals, fairs, and party ambiance. The city sees a good deal of drug-connected crimes and in 2020, it experienced the highest homicide charge of any city in Brazil, with sixty seven.five homicides for every a hundred,000 folks. As well as getting deemed Brazil’s most unsafe city, Feira de Santana ranks as the 9th most hazardous town in the entire world and is one of many Bahia cities to feature on this list.

State: Rio Grande do Norte
Population: 300,000

Despite the fact that Mossoro has all around half the inhabitants of Feira de Santana, it is nearly as fatal with sixty two.21 homicides for every 100,000 people. Mossoro is acknowledged for having abolished slavery five many years prior to the relaxation of the country, and for currently being the initial metropolis that allowed women to vote, in 1928.

The city itself does not have any seashores, but there are several good beaches in a quite brief distance and in June, it hosts the Mossoro Junina Metropolis Festival, which sees a lot more than a million people visit the area. Economically, the metropolis has been greatly involved in petroleum and salt production and the quantity of travelers implies that the town is inclined to pickpockets and robbers.

Rocinha is a favela of Rio de Janeiro and whilst it has a populace of just 70,000, it is the greatest favela in the country. It has also had this sort of a high crime price, that, in 2011, hundreds of law enforcement and troopers marched the streets to cramp down on drug working and drug crimes. In 2017, drug kingpin Rogerio da Silva was arrested in Rocinha after the work of three,000 armed forces and police personnel, and it was below that a tourist was unintentionally killed by police in 2017.
